FSC real wood frame with double mounted 24x20 print. Double mounted with white conservation mountboard. Frame moulding comprises stained composite natural wood veneers (Finger Jointed Pine) 39mm wide by 21mm thick. Archival quality Fujifilm CA photo paper mounted onto 1mm card. Overall outside dimensions are 31x27 inches (787x685mm). Rear features Framing tape to cover staples, 50mm Hanger plate, cork bumpers. Glazed with durable thick 2mm Acrylic to provide a virtually unbreakable glass-like finish. Acrylic Glass is far safer, more flexible and much lighter than typical mineral glass. Moreover, its higher translucency makes it a perfect carrier for photo prints. Acrylic allows a little more light to penetrate the surface than conventional glass and absorbs UV rays so that the image and the picture quality doesn't suffer under direct sunlight even after many years. Easily cleaned with a damp cloth. In this photo print, we are transported back to November 1975, a moment frozen in time that captures the essence of sporting greatness. The image showcases three football legends standing side by side - George Best, Peter Osgood, and Alan Hudson. Their faces reflect determination and camaraderie as they prepare for Peter Osgood's testimonial match. George Best, known for his mesmerizing skills on the field and charismatic personality off it, stands at the forefront of the trio. His magnetic presence is undeniable as he exudes confidence and flair even in stillness. Beside him stands Peter Osgood, a revered figure in English football history with his striking goal-scoring abilities and unwavering loyalty to Chelsea Football Club. Completing this formidable trio is Alan Hudson, an immensely talented midfielder who left an indelible mark on the game during his career.
